FAQs on French Style Display Cabinets

What should I display in a French style cabinet?

Display fine china, glassware, vases, photo frames, books and collectibles. Place lighter decorative items on upper shelves and heavier pieces lower down. Glass doors protect your display from dust while keeping items visible and showcased throughout your home.

Measure your wall space in centimetres and consider your ceiling height. Narrow cabinets fit snugly in corners; wide designs suit feature walls. Account for your collection size—larger pieces suit big living rooms, while compact cabinets work in smaller spaces without overwhelming the room.

Group items by colour, height and type for visual balance. Place taller pieces at the back, shorter items forward. Mix textures—pair glassware with ceramics and books. Leave breathing room between items; overcrowding reduces impact. Lighting inside cabinets highlights your collection beautifully.

Wipe painted and wood finishes with a soft dry cloth; use a slightly damp cloth for marks, then dry thoroughly. Clean glass with gentle glass cleaner and a microfibre c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als on shabby chic or painted surfaces. Dust regularly to keep displays looking fresh.

Yes, always secure tall cabinets to the wall using the fixings provided for safety, especially in homes with children or pets. Wall fixings prevent tipping and ensure stability when shelves are fully loaded with heavy items. Our team can advise on fitting before delivery.

Display cabinets feature glass doors and shelves for showcasing decorative items. Dressers have drawers and cupboards for storage, with less emphasis on display. Choose a display cabinet if you want items visible; a dresser if you need hidden storage and don't mind items being concealed.
